牛津词典
noun
- 合作者;协作者;合著者
a person who works with another person to create or produce sth such as a book - 通敌者
a person who helps the enemy in a war, when they have taken control of the person's country
柯林斯词典
- N-COUNT (研究方面的)合作者,协作者;(书的)合著者
Acollaboratoris someone that you work with to produce a piece of work, especially a book or some research.- The Irvine group and their collaborators are testing whether lasers do the job better.
欧文研究小组和他们的合作伙伴正在测试激光是否会更为有效。

- N-COUNT 通敌者;(与占领军)勾结的人
Acollaboratoris someone who helps an enemy who is occupying their country during a war.- Two alleged collaborators were shot dead by masked activists.
两名涉嫌通敌者被蒙面的激进分子击毙。
